Aluminum Engine Component Case Studies Key Properties of Aluminum for Engine Applications Lightweight / Low Density: Aluminum Engine Component Case Studies show significant reductions in part and vehicle weight compared to traditional cast iron, leading to better fuel economy and improved handling dynamics. High Thermal Conductivity: Facilitates efficient heat dissipation from the engine, improving thermal efficiency and allowing for higher performance designs. Good Castability: Easily formed into complex shapes using processes like die casting and gravity casting. Good Machinability: Relatively easy to machine to precise tolerances. Good Corrosion Resistance: The naturally forming oxide layer provides inherent protection. High Recyclability: Aligns with sustainability goals.
